dc.description.abstractThe specific complexity of the question of genres depends on the plurality of the problems to which genre is pertinent and relevant. When Croce proclaimed, at the beginning of the century, the non-existence of the genre, he reduced the entire range of problems to the sole question relative to a work’s belonging to a genre. In more recent times, there has been an attempt to reduce genre to the property of the linguistic act, in a methodological framework that understands poetics exclusively as the science of literature. Against such reductionism, it is important to keep in mind a wider, more articulated idea of poetics as a pragmatic meditation, to investigate genres according to the multiple lines of systematization that are pertinent to them.es_ES
